/**
 * Design tokens från The Pot (ave-child anpassningar + din klistrade CSS).
 * Typsnitt: Munken Sans (@font-face sätts i functions.php med absoluta URL:er).
 *
 * Obs: I den klistrade CSS:en dominerar svart/vitt + mörka överlägg (rgba).
 * Varken vinröd/burgundy eller separata gråkoder nämns där — därför finns
 * "mörkgrå" som läsbar sekundärtext; lägg till en accentfärg när ni har hex från live.
 */

:root {
  color-scheme: light;

  /* —— Varumärke / ytor (ur din CSS: knappar, kapacitet, gradient) —— */
  --color-black: #000000;
  --color-white: #ffffff;
  --color-text: #000000;
  --color-text-muted: #4a4a4a;
  --color-border: #000000;

  /* Hero / overlay (valj-stad m.m.) */
  --color-overlay-scrim: rgb(0 0 0 / 30%);
  --color-grid-caption-gradient: linear-gradient(
    0deg,
    rgb(0 0 0),
    rgb(0 0 0) 100%,
    transparent
  );

  /* Knappar: .trigger-bokning, .gform_button, .trigger-bokning-karlshamn */
  --color-button-bg: var(--color-black);
  --color-button-text: var(--color-white);
  --color-button-border: var(--color-black);
  --color-button-hover-bg: var(--color-white);
  --color-button-hover-text: var(--color-black);
  --button-padding-y: 7px;
  --button-padding-x: 12px;
  --button-radius: 4px;
  --button-transition: all 0.3s ease-in-out;

  /* Rubriker (standardläge — vit används bara ovanpå bilder i egna block) */
  --color-heading: var(--color-black);

  /* Alias för befintliga mallar */
  --bg: var(--color-white);
  --fg: var(--color-text);
  --muted: var(--color-text-muted);
  --accent: var(--color-black);
  --border: #dedede;

  /* —— Typografi: Munken Sans för bröd + rubriker (samma familj i din CSS) —— */
  --font-family-sans: "Munken Sans", system-ui, -apple-system, sans-serif;
  --font-family-body: var(--font-family-sans);
  --font-family-heading: var(--font-family-sans);

  --font-size-body: 1rem;
  --line-height-body: 1.6;
  --font-weight-body: 400;
  --font-weight-heading: 500;
  --font-weight-strong: 700;

  /* Skala: .valj-stad h1 40px (mobil), .header-text h2 1.8rem, kapacitet 16px */
  --font-size-h1: clamp(2rem, 4vw, 2.5rem);
  --font-size-h2: clamp(1.65rem, 2.5vw, 1.8rem);
  --font-size-h3: 1.375rem;
  --font-size-h4: 1.125rem;
  --font-size-h5: 1rem;
  --font-size-h6: 1.2rem;
  --line-height-heading: 1.2;

  /* —— Layout / spacing —— */
  --content-max-width: 1200px;
  --space-heading-block: 1.25em 0 0.75em;
  --space-paragraph-after: 1.3em;
  --space-header-y: 1.5rem;
  --space-header-x: clamp(1rem, 4vw, 2rem);
  --space-main-y: clamp(1.5rem, 4vw, 2.5rem);
  --space-main-x: clamp(1rem, 4vw, 2rem);
  --space-footer-margin-top: 3rem;
  --space-list-item-y: 1rem;
  --space-capacity-gap: 20px;
  --radius-pill: 999px;

  /* Valfri accent — sätt om ni har exakt burgundy från tryck/profil (saknas i klistrad CSS) */
  --color-accent: var(--color-black);
}
